Explore in-spoilt beaches and areas of the Murrumbidgee River through the Wilbriggie Regional Park (East).
Access from Darlington Point is via Beach Road on the southern side of Whitton Road. The road becomes dirt as you enter the Wilbriggie Regional Park. Explore beaches, such as Reserve Beach, Lady Jane Beach, Boomerang Beach, Waradgy Beach, Diggers Beach, and The Point Beach to pick out the best spot for you to relax.
Not suitable for caravans, but 4WD and camping are permitted.
Please obey all signs throughout the Regional Park.
